#bec4d2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bec4d2 is composed of 74.5% red, 76.9% green and 82.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 9.5% cyan, 6.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 222 degrees, a saturation of 18.2% and a lightness of 78.4%. #bec4d2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#7d89a5.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

Shades and Tints of #bec4d2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030405 is the darkest color, while #f8f9fa is the lightest one.
